SMFD + Serpas True Food = A Sumptuous Experience

Atlanta, Georgia (March 2, 2009) Skylar Morgan Furniture + Design (SMFD) announces the modern design company’s most recent collaboration—furniture and interior millwork for fine dining darling Scott Serpas’ newest endeavor, Serpas True Food.

Housed in a former cotton storage facility at the StudioPlex loft development in Atlanta’s historic Old Fourth Ward, True Food is, in Serpas’ own words, the embodiment of “approachable,” and evocative of “classic comfort food.” It’s an aesthetic directive that modernist millworkers SMFD took beyond the restaurant’s edible offerings—literally, to the tables themselves. And the walls. And the bar. And the reception area.

SMFD Principal Skylar Morgan was tapped by Chef Serpas and May Architects of Atlanta to complement the restaurant’s industrial-chic, casual-meets contemporary space with a modern but warm patina. “Initially, they wanted stained hickory,” says Morgan. “But I’m not often inclined to just do my part and get out of the way. So, I brought a few ideas to the table, and we came up with something really interesting and unique.”

Morgan chose creamy, solid planks for tabletops, tinted a bit more wood just slightly for architectural cubbies and bar shelves, then suggested a material that favored the space’s well-worn vibe note for note. His choice: hickory panels that would ordinarily be designated as waste wood. They bare their knots, splits, ridges and all in random-width fields that ring the bar at ceiling level. Combined with acid-stained concrete floors and original warehouse door panels mounted as found art, the overall look is complex, curious, and detailed enough to spurn suitable dinner conversation. “I want people to think twice about my work,” says Morgan. “Be inquisitive. Think about the furniture. Start a dialogue. Look further.”

In addition to this work at Serpas, Morgan and SMFD have lent their talents to a number of residential and high-end commercial design projects all over modern, minimalist Atlanta, including Nani Salon + Spa, White Provisions, W Hotel, and most recently Verde Home, where interested buyers can purchase a number of Morgan’s furniture pieces.
